Training Services

Programming Xilinx Zynq SoCs with MATLAB and Simulink

This hands-on, two-day course focuses on developing and configuring models in the Simulink® environment and deploying on Xilinx® Zynq®-7000 all programmable SoCs. The course is designed for Simulink users who intend to generate, validate, and deploy embedded code and HDL code for software/hardware codesign using Embedded Coder® and HDL Coder. A ZedBoard™ is provided to each attendee for use throughout the course. The board is programmed during the class and is yours to keep after the training.

Topics include:

  • Zynq platform overview and environment setup
  • Introduction to Embedded Coder
  • Introduction to HDL Coder
  • IP core generation and deployment
  • Parameter tuning with External Mode
  • Processor-in-the-loop verification
  • Fixed-point design
  • Data interface with real-time application
  • Developing device drivers
  • Design partitioning

Training Formats

Format Course Length Course Outline

Classroom

Course is led by a MathWorks instructor in a focused classroom setting. Locations include MathWorks offices and public sites worldwide; classroom training can also take place at your facility

2 Days View details

Prerequisites

Simulink for System and Algorithm Modeling (or Simulink for Automotive System Design or Simulink for Aerospace System Design) and Model Management and Verification in Simulink. Knowledge of C and HDL programming languages.